The process is pretty standard. You pop in your phone number, Dodo Pizza sends a 4-6 digit one-time passcode (OTP) via SMS, and you're in. Usually, it takes less than 30 seconds.
But here's where it breaks. Your network might be slow. The app's SMS provider might be throttling retries. Or, most commonly, you've already used that number on another account. The code arrives via standard SMS, no data plan needed. If you don't type it in fast enough, the code expires. And if you keep hitting " resend," you might get a temporary IP ban.And if you keep hitting "resend," you might get a temporary IP ban.
This is the million-dollar question. The most common culprits are:
Carrier blocking: Your mobile provider might be blocking the shortcode it's coming from.
Roaming issues: If you're abroad, your SMS session might be inactive.
Number reuse: The app's system flags your number as "already registered."
Blocked prefixes: Some virtual numbers are from carriers Dodo Pizza has blocked. Picking the right pool is key .Picking the right pool is key.
Other hidden causes include blocked IPs from previous attempts, carrier filtering that strips out promotional SMS, and simple request timeouts. The fix isn't fighting with your carrier; it's using a number that avoids these problems entirely.

If you're stubborn and want to try your real SIM first, here are a few things to try:
Restart your phone and toggle aeroplane mode on/off.
Clear the app cache in your settings.
Contact your carrier and ask if they block third-party SMS shortcodes.
Check if you've accidentally blocked "Dodo Pizza" in your messaging app.
Try a different Wi-Fi network to rule out IP filtering.
Wait 24 hours before trying again to avoid a rate limit ban.
